
4E-BP1 Antibody (D-10) is a mouse monoclonal IgG2a antibody that detects 4E-BP1 in mouse, rat, and human samples through various applications including western blotting (WB), immunoprecipitation (IP), immunofluorescence (IF), immunohistochemistry with paraffin-embedded sections (IHCP), and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). 4E-BP1, also known as PHAS-I, plays a crucial role in the regulation of protein synthesis by inhibiting the function of eIF-4E, a key component of the eIF-4F complex that initiates translation. When phosphorylated by kinases such as S6 kinase p70, MAP kinases, or protein kinase C, 4E-BP1 dissociates from eIF-4E, thereby promoting the assembly of the translation initiation complex and enhancing protein synthesis. This regulatory mechanism is vital for processes such as cell growth, proliferation, and survival, making anti-4E-BP1 antibody (D-10) a significant tool for studying cancer biology and other diseases where protein synthesis is dysregulated.
